Norfork among victorious schools on opening day of Arvest Bank Tournament

The Arvest Bank Tournament began Saturday in Flippin.

Norfork was able to win its opener on the boys’ bracket. The Panthers defeated Deer by a final of 39-23.

Mammoth Spring was able to edge out Western Grove 59-56. Sagen Godwin led the Bears with 32 points, and Daniel Mayfield added ten. Mammoth Spring improves to 5-2 on the season. Their next game in the tournament will be Wednesday against Deer. The Bears will host Cotter for district play on Tuesday.

Norfork was also victorious on the girls’ side. The Lady Panthers topped Bruno-Pyatt 79-7.

Yellville-Summit will be the Lady Patriots’ next opponent Wednesday in the consolation bracket. The Lady Panthers fell to Calico Rock 48-46. Yellville-Summit was led by Taylor McFarland with 27 points and 14 rebounds.

Mammoth Spring was able to win its girls’ game 82-32 over Deer. Whitlee Layne was the Lady Bears’ top scorer with 28 points, Terra Godwin had 19, and Brianna Hocum chipped in 16. Mammoth Spring remains unbeaten in eight games on the season, and they’ll face Cotter Monday in the quarterfinals.
